An Art and Science of Creation: A Journey Through Diffusion Models
Diffusion models have emerged as a revolutionary force in the realm of artificial intelligence, propelling the boundaries of creative expression. These intricate algorithms, based in statistical principles, allow machines to generate novel and surprising content, from stunningly realistic images to coherent and engaging text. The process begins with a dataset of existing data, which is progressively corrupted by random noise. Through a collection of carefully calibrated steps, the model learns to reverse this noise, effectively creating new data points that resemble the original dataset.
This journey through diffusion models unveils an intriguing interplay between art and science. The algorithms themselves are a testament to human ingenuity, while the generated outputs challenge our perceptions of creativity. As we delve deeper into this novel territory, we discover the immense potential of diffusion models to transform the way we create and immerse with the world around us.
